Form, composition, packaging and description of the medicinal product

The drug "Lovastatin", the instruction for its use is packed in a cardboard pack, is sold in the form of white and round tablets. The active ingredient of this medication is lovastatin. As for the auxiliary components, they include lactose monohydrate, starch, cellulose, ascorbic acid, butyl hydroxy anisole, citric acid and magnesium stearate.

The medicine is produced in cell blisters and packs of cardboard, respectively.

Mechanism of action of the drug

What is the principle of the action of the drug "Lovastatin"? Instructions for use, annotation report that LP-receptors of the liver regulate the content of lipoproteins in the blood. From it they are derived through interaction with these receptors. As a result, cholesterol is synthesized in liver cells.

The principle of action of the drug in question is due to the suppression of 3-hydroxy-3-methylglutaryl-coenzyme A reductase. This enzyme, with the participation of which the synthesis of cholesterol.

Reducing the formation of cholesterol entails a compensatory increase in the number of LP-receptors on hepatocytes. As a result of this action, the process of removing low density lipoprotein from the blood is accelerated, and the total cholesterol, low-density and intermediate-density lipoprotein cholesterol is also reduced.

Features of the drug

What other properties do Lovastatin tablets have? Instructions for use (price, reviews are presented at the end of the article) indicate that this agent is able to reduce the content of apolipoprotein B and triglycerides, and also slightly increase the level of high-density lipoproteins.

The therapeutic effect after taking the medication is manifested after two weeks, and the maximum - about a month and a half later. In this case, it persists for six weeks after the withdrawal of the drug.

The effectiveness of the drug for prolonged use does not decrease. It should also be noted that it is obtained from the biocultures of Aspergillus terreus and Monascus ruber.

Kinetic properties

How long is the drug "Lovastatin" absorbed? Instructions for use (the price of the drug is not very high) claims that the absorption of this drug from the digestive tract is slow. Moreover, it reduces the intake of tablets on an empty stomach.

The biological availability of this agent is very low (about 30% of the dose taken). Approximately four hours later, the highest concentration of the drug in the blood is reached. Another day later it decreases and is about 10% of the maximum.

The drug in question is 95% bound to plasma proteins. The clearance of the drug with a single admission is noted for 3 days.

What is the drug "Lovastatin"? Instruction for use reports that this is a prodrug. After the first passage through the liver, it takes on an active form.

The drug is metabolized by isozymes. Its half-life is 180 minutes. The active element of the drug, as well as its metabolites are excreted by the kidneys and through the intestine.

Indications for taking tablets

If there are any conditions, the patient is prescribed Lovastatin tablets? The instructions for use (the description, the composition of the preparation were presented at the very beginning of the article) informs that this remedy is very effective in the primary hypercholesterolemia (hypolipoproteinemia IIb and IIa types) with a high content of LDL (if dietotherapy in people with an increased risk of developing coronary atherosclerosis was ineffective) , As well as combined hypertriglyceridemia and hypercholesterolemia.

It should also be noted that the drug under consideration is often prescribed for atherosclerosis.

Contraindications to the use of a prodrug

When is a patient not recommended to use Lovastatin tablets? Instructions for use (treatment with this drug should be prescribed only by a doctor) informs that this remedy is contraindicated in active liver diseases, pregnancy or its probability, increased activity of transaminases of unknown origin, as well as during breast-feeding, in severe condition of the patient (general) and increased Sensitivity to lovastatin.

Also, the medication in question is not prescribed at a minor age, with myopathy and cholestasis.

It is forbidden to combine with the reception of alcoholic beverages. With special care, it is prescribed to patients after coronary artery bypass grafting.

The drug "Lovastatin": instructions for use

The price, analogues of this tool will be examined below.

According to the attached instructions, tablets "Lovastatin" should be taken orally during dinner once a day.

With such a pathological condition as hyperlipidemia, the drug is prescribed in an amount of 10-80 mg once (the dose depends on the severity of the disease).

Treatment with the drug in question begins with small doses. Then it is gradually increased. The greatest daily dosage of the drug, equal to 80 mg, can be taken once or twice a day (in the morning and before bedtime). Selection of a therapeutic dose is carried out with an interval of one month.

As with coronary atherosclerosis, the drug "Lovastatin" is prescribed? Instruction for use informs that with such a disease the drug is prescribed in a dose of 20-40 mg. If the indicated amount of the drug was ineffective, then it is increased to 60-80 mg.

When the drug is combined with fibrates or nicotinic acid, its dosage should not be more than 20 mg per day.

Adverse events

Does the drug "Lovastatin" cause side effects? Instruction for use indicates the following undesirable phenomena:

  • Cataract, headaches;
  • Atrophy of the optic nerve, dizziness;
  • Insomnia, sleep disorders, anxiety, general weakness, paresthesia;
  • Muscle cramps, myalgia, myositis
  • In people taking nicotinic acid, "Cyclosporine" or "Gemfibrozil", the risk of rhabdomyolysis increases;
  • Thrombocytopenia, hemolytic anemia;
  • Heartburn, biliary cholestasis, nausea, hepatitis, flatulence, taste perversion, constipation, cholestatic jaundice, diarrhea;
  • Increased activity of creatine phosphokinase and liver transaminase;
  • Increased bilirubin and alkaline phosphatase ;
  • Quincke's edema, rash, itching, arthralgia, urticaria;
  • Alopecia and decreased potency.

An overdose of a drug

If the patient does not receive high doses of medication, no specific symptoms are observed in the patient.

When observing pathological conditions, the affected person is washed with a stomach and prescribed to take sorbents. The patient is also monitored for vital functions, liver function and creatine phosphokinase activity.

Drug Interactions

Simultaneous use of a large amount of grapefruit juice, as well as "Gemfibrozil" and "Fenofibrate" contributes to a great risk of myopathy.

Taking a drug with nicotinic acid, Clarithromycin, Erythromycin, Cyclosporin, antifungal medicines (Itraconazole, Ketoconazole), Nefazodone and Ritonavir leads to an increase in the concentration of the drug in the blood, as well as the destruction of the muscle Tissue and risk of myopathy.

The joint appointment of "Lovastatin" with "Warfarin" increases the risk of bleeding.

The drug "Kolestyramin" reduces the bioavailability of the drug in question. Therefore, the time interval between their reception should be at least 2-4 hours.

Special Recommendations

With extreme caution, the drug "Lovastatin" is prescribed to people with liver diseases in history. The same applies to chronic alcoholism.

It should also be noted that this drug is canceled in the case of a persistent increase in liver transaminases or CK.

According to experts, lipid-lowering drugs are used in complex treatment, as well as for the prevention of atherosclerosis and its complications.

The principle of action of this medication is to reduce the content of atherogenic lipoproteins in the blood

According to the doctors, at present there is a rather large experience of clinical use of "Lovastatin". It is one of the safest medicines. This drug has a fairly good tolerability with prolonged therapy.

In patients' reviews, very rarely are complaints of side effects. Sometimes this medicine can cause flatulence, diarrhea, abdominal pain, constipation, insomnia and muscle pain. Typically, such reactions disappear two weeks after the initiation of therapy or as a result of dose reduction.
